Convert group pair (q,l)
Gives the index in 1, …, Q^2 (directed) or 1, …, Q*(Q+1)/2 (undirected) that corresponds to group pair (q,l). Works also for vectors of indices q and l.
convertGroupPair(q, l, Q, directed = TRUE)
q |
Group index q |
l |
Group index l |
Q |
Total number of groups Q |
directed |
Boolean for directed (TRUE) or undirected (FALSE) case |
Relations between groups (q,l) are stored in vectors, whose indexes depend on whether the graph is directed or undirected.
The (q,l) group pair is converted into the index (q-1)*Q+l
The (q,l) group pair with q<=l is converted into the index (2*Q-q+2)*(q-1)/2 +l-q+1
Index corresponding to the group pair (q,l)
# Convert the group pair (3,2) into an index, where the total number of group is 3, # for directed and undirected graph q <- 3 l <- 2 Q <- 3 directedIndex <- convertGroupPair(q,l,Q) undirectedIndex <- convertGroupPair(q,l,Q, FALSE)
